An alloy of lead (valency = 2) and thallium (valency = 1) containing 65% Pb and 35% Tl, by weight, can be electroplated onto a cathode from a solution. How many gram of this alloy will deposit in 9.65 hours using a constant current of 0.5 amp?
[Given that only these two elements deposit simultaneously in given mass ratio at cathode]
[Atomic weight Pb=208,Tl=200]
